Output dd43bd03a5d628b72e63d11eb9893cca0e86e65b2dff3888a40a19e89decf70d:0

value
33150299
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48a27441c92ddcf5aa1c08aec0c1b0e087fdd612 OP_EQUAL
address
38K5BsCUehrnMNL9ZUvjzq9KSKdTyBWT6D
transaction
dd43bd03a5d628b72e63d11eb9893cca0e86e65b2dff3888a40a19e89decf70d
spent
true